How do you restore NuGet packages in a build pipeline?
Short answer: How do you restore NuGet packages in a build pipeline? Answer: Use either: script: dotnet restore or task: NuGetCommand@2 inputs: command: 'restore' This pulls dependencies from NuGet.org or an internal feed. Example: If your project uses private packages, you can add a NuGet service connection or Azure Artifacts feed to authenticate.
